Miter Saw Mastery: Cutting Aluminium with Precision
Achieving perfect sections of aluminum with your miter saw demands special techniques. Unlike wood, this material tends to gum to the cutting surface , potentially causing a uneven edge and binding. To prevent this, always use a micro-tooth blade built for aluminum . Lowering the pace – that's how fast you push the metal into the blade – is critical ; a slow approach yields significantly improved results. Furthermore , dampening the blade with a lubricant can minimize friction and enhance the final cut quality .
